Port isolation allows a network administrator to prevent traffic from being sent between isolated ports. This article outlines how to configure isolated ports, as. Port Isolation restricts communication between specific ports on the same switch. They can still communicate with non-isolated ports.     These Fast and Gigabit Ethernet to fiber optic converters have been designed for harsh industrial environments and withstand a wide temperature of -40°F to 185°F (-40°C to 85°C), and they come with the options of multi-mode and single-mode, and ST, SC, FC, and SFP connectors.
